angularjs相容很多主流的瀏覽器,具有無與倫比的特性,能够幫助用戶進行web方面的架構,可以和其他框架進行友好的連接,讓用戶享受到快速的web開發。

框架介紹
開發動態Web應用的框架。 它讓你可以使用HTML作為範本語言並且可以通過擴展的HTML語法來使應用組件更加清晰和簡潔。 它的創新之處在於,通過數據綁定和依賴注入减少了大量程式碼,而這些都在瀏覽器端通過JavaScript實現,能够和任何伺服器端科技完美結合。
優點說明
可以尅隆和重複HTML元素。
可以隱藏和顯示HTML元素。
把應用程序數據綁定到HTML元素。
支持輸入驗證。
可以在HTML元素“背後”添加程式碼。
angularjs四大特性
–雙向數據綁定
方向1:Model綁定到View,此後不論何時只要Model發生改變,View會自動立即同步更新。
方向2:View綁定到Model,把視圖中用戶可以修改的HTML元素——即表單控制項的值綁定到一個Model變數上。 此後不論何時只要用戶修改了表單控制項的值,後臺模型變數的值會立即隨之改變。
–MVC模型
Model:模型,即業務數據,在前端應用中就是保存在特定範圍的JS變數;
(1)在angular應用中可以申明多個模塊(module)
(2)一個模塊中可以申明多種組件,如:controller、directive、service、filter……
(3)某個模塊依賴於其他模塊
(4)有一個模塊必須注册給ngApp指令–啟動模塊
View:視圖,即業務數據在用戶面前的呈現,在前端應用中就是HTML;
Controller:控制器,負責業務數據的獲取、修改、删除等,在前端應用中由function來當擔。
–模組化開發
這個按照我自己的理解,是angularJS的一種開發思想,將一個大的工程劃分成若干小的部分,便於開發管理和維護。
–依賴注入
如果需要那些對象可以在參數中直接寫出來,然後就可以在函數的使用了,這些對象不需要你自己創建,它本身已經被angular創建好了,你就可以直接使用了。
angularjs最新版 2022 免費版本
下載位址: